Traveling Archivist, Kansas Historical Society, Topeka, KS
Posted May 14, 2025
Description
The Kansas Historical Society seeks to hire a Traveling Archivist to support the State Archives in providing onsite consultation to promote records management and archives best practices for local and state government agencies and offices. The candidate will participate in preservation projects to improve overall access to historically significant Kansas government records and develop records retention and disposition schedules.
